The buffet was below average with very limited options in the main course. The food taste was not up to the mark. The starters, especially the paneer, were very hard and not enjoyable. The daal makhani lacked flavour, and the steamed rice was also disappointing as it was completely watery. There was no buffet menu available, so guests had to walk around and check the options themselves. Service was quite slow despite having adequate staff basic observations and guest requests were delayed. Table clearance also took a long time. I also noticed inconsistency in service finger bowls were served to some tables but not to all. Overall, the experience did not match the expectations associated with JW Marriott
